  1. This author is known for his use of dialect
    Mark Twain
  2. This author wrote To Build a Fire
    Jack London
  3. This boy did bad things but never got caught
    The Bad Little Boy
  4. This man was known for his charm and good looks
    Richard Cory
  5. This author wrote The Outcasts of Poker Flat
    Bret Harte
  6. This boy wanted his name in the Sunday School books
    The Good Little Boy
  7. the will to survive in To Build a Fire is an ex of
    internal conflict
  8. This story was banned from print when it was first released
    The Story of an Hour
  9. method a writer uses to reveal the personality of a character
    characterization
  10. the use of humor, irony, or exaggeration to make a point
    satire
  11. A story within a story
    frame story
  12. This character died of heart disease
    Mrs. Mallard
  13. the use of reason and personal experience to understand meaning that is implied
    inference
  14. The Celebrated Jumping Frog is an example of this literary movement
    Regionalism
  15. This author wrote The Story of an Hour
    Kate Chopin
  16. This author wrote Richard Cory and Miniver Cheevy
    Edwin Arlington Robinson
  17. the opposite of what is expected
    irony
  18. The Story of an Hour is an example of this literary movement
    Realism
  19. language spoken by a particular group often within a specific region
    dialect
  20. the harsh weather conditions in To Build a Fire is an ex of
    external conflict
  21. The man built a fire because his feet got wet is an ex. of
    cause & effect
  22. This story is an example of a frame story
    The Celebrated Jumping Frog of Calaveras County
  23. To Build a Fire is an example of this literary movement
    Naturalism
  24. This man wished he lived in a different time
    Miniver Cheevy
